Product Description
Simpson 12d x 3-1/4" Preservative-Treated Wood Decking Nail in Type 316 Stainless Steel is a high-performance exterior fastener engineered by Simpson Strong-Tie for deck and dock construction. Featuring an annular-ring shank and a full round checkered head, this nail delivers superior holding power and long-term corrosion resistance in outdoor environments where pressure-treated lumber and moisture exposure are constant challenges. The 9-gauge, 0.148" shank diameter is specifically sized to drive cleanly into both green and seasoned preservative-treated pine, making installation straightforward whether you are building a new deck, replacing damaged boards, or constructing a dock near salt water. With Type 316 stainless steel construction, this fastener is the right choice for coastal and high-humidity applications where standard galvanized nails would corrode prematurely.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Why should I choose Type 316 stainless steel over Type 304 for my deck project?
- Type 316 stainless steel contains additional molybdenum compared to Type 304, which significantly improves its resistance to chlorides, salt water, and the chemicals found in preservative-treated lumber. If your project is near the ocean, a lake, or involves ACQ or similar treated wood, Type 316 is the recommended grade because it resists the accelerated corrosion that would compromise a Type 304 or galvanized fastener over time.
- What does an annular-ring shank do differently than a smooth shank nail?
- An annular-ring shank has a series of ridges along its length that lock into the surrounding wood fibers as the nail is driven. This mechanical grip dramatically increases withdrawal resistance - meaning the nail resists being pulled back out far more than a smooth shank nail of the same size. For outdoor decking that expands and contracts seasonally, this prevents nail heads from gradually working up through the board surface over time.
- Can this nail be used in both green and seasoned preservative-treated pine?
- Yes. The 9-gauge, 0.148" shank diameter is specifically sized to penetrate both green (freshly treated, higher moisture content) and seasoned (dried) preservative-treated pine. The diamond point also helps start the nail cleanly in denser or wetter wood, reducing the effort required during installation without pre-drilling.
- Is the checkered head pattern purely cosmetic or does it serve a function?
- The checkered head pattern on this decking nail serves both a functional and aesthetic purpose. Functionally, the texture helps blend the nail head with the visual grain of the wood surface. Aesthetically, it reduces glare from direct sunlight on the metal head, resulting in a cleaner finished appearance on your deck surface compared to a smooth bright head.
